From f6a912c1a6a26c809568f964941fb4ad4483274e Mon Sep 17 00:00:00 2001
From: Helius <wangdoubleone@gmail.com>
Date: Mon, 31 May 2021 11:19:40 +0800
Subject: [PATCH] modify
---
src/main/java/com/xcong/excoin/quartz/job/LoopExecutorJob.java | 28 ++++++++++++++++++++++------
1 files changed, 22 insertions(+), 6 deletions(-)
diff --git a/src/main/java/com/xcong/excoin/quartz/job/LoopExecutorJob.java b/src/main/java/com/xcong/excoin/quartz/job/LoopExecutorJob.java
index eda6f7f..6b2ef68 100644
--- a/src/main/java/com/xcong/excoin/quartz/job/LoopExecutorJob.java
+++ b/src/main/java/com/xcong/excoin/quartz/job/LoopExecutorJob.java
@@ -1,5 +1,6 @@
package com.xcong.excoin.quartz.job;
+import com.xcong.excoin.modules.coin.service.OrderCoinService;
import com.xcong.excoin.modules.contract.service.ContractHoldOrderService;
import com.xcong.excoin.modules.home.dao.MemberQuickBuySaleDao;
import lombok.extern.slf4j.Slf4j;
@@ -16,7 +17,7 @@
**/
@Slf4j
@Component
-@ConditionalOnProperty(prefix = "app", name = "loop-job", havingValue = "true")
+@ConditionalOnProperty(prefix = "app", name = "otc-job", havingValue = "true")
public class LoopExecutorJob {
@Resource
@@ -24,6 +25,9 @@
@Resource
private ContractHoldOrderService contractHoldOrderService;
+
+ @Resource
+ private OrderCoinService orderCoinService;
/**
* 更新快捷充值超时状态
@@ -42,13 +46,25 @@
/**
* 持仓费计算
*/
- @Scheduled(cron = "0 0 0 */1 * ?")
- public void updateDoingPrice() {
- log.info("#持仓费计算#");
+// @Scheduled(cron = "0 0 0/8 * * ?")
+// public void updateDoingPrice() {
+// log.info("#持仓费计算#");
+// try {
+// contractHoldOrderService.calHoldFeeAmountForBondAmount();
+// } catch (Exception e) {
+// log.error("#持仓费计算错误#", e);
+// }
+// }
+
+ /**
+ * 币币委托单成交
+ */
+ @Scheduled(cron = "0/5 * * * * ? ")
+ public void coinEntrustToDeal() {
try {
- contractHoldOrderService.calHoldOrderHoldFeeAmount();
+ orderCoinService.dealEntrustCoinOrder();
} catch (Exception e) {
- log.error("#持仓费计算错误#", e);
+ log.error("#币币委托单成交错误#", e);
}
}
}
--
Gitblit v1.9.1